Seferihisar

Seferihisar, located along Türkiye's picturesque Aegean coast, is proudly recognized as one of the country's "slow cities." This charming town invites you to slow down and embrace a more relaxed pace of life. With its serene streets, stunning beaches, and vibrant local markets, Seferihisar offers the perfect setting for those seeking a peaceful getaway. Here, you can immerse yourself in authentic Turkish culture, savor fresh, locally sourced cuisine, and enjoy a more mindful, unhurried experience. It’s the ideal destination to unwind, recharge, and enjoy the simple pleasures of life.

Gökçeada

Gökçeada, an idyllic island in the Aegean Sea, is a hidden gem perfect for slow travel. Famous for its untouched natural beauty, rustic charm, and tranquil atmosphere, Gökçeada provides a serene retreat away from the hustle and bustle. Here, you can leisurely explore scenic hiking trails, savor local wine at intimate tastings, and wander through charming villages, all while avoiding the crowds of mass tourism. Gökçeada offers an authentic, unhurried escape where you can truly reconnect with nature and the local way of life.

Best Seasons and Timing for Slow Travel

Timing is a crucial element in the slow travel experience. One of the key advantages of slow travel is the ability to travel during off-peak seasons, when destinations are less crowded, allowing you to truly immerse yourself in the tranquility and charm of a place. Spring and autumn are particularly ideal for slow travel, as the weather is mild and the crowds are thinner. This gives you the perfect opportunity to explore serene destinations like Fethiye, Göynük, Seferihisar, and Gökçeada without the usual tourist hustle, allowing you to relax, take in the beauty around you, and enjoy everything at your own leisurely pace.

Packing Essentials for a Relaxed and Enjoyable Journey

When preparing for a slow travel adventure, packing efficiently is key to ensuring a smooth and enjoyable journey. Since slow travel is all about savoring every moment and embracing a relaxed pace, it’s important to pack only the essentials that will keep you comfortable and ready for a stress-free experience. By focusing on versatility and practicality, you can create a packing list that perfectly complements the slow travel philosophy. This allows you to immerse yourself in the destination, without being bogged down by unnecessary items, so you can fully enjoy the peace and beauty of your surroundings. Keep it simple, and let your journey unfold naturally. Here are some slow travel tips on the must-have items to bring along for a truly peaceful and fulfilling trip:

  • Comfortable Footwear: Since slow travel is all about exploring at a relaxed pace, be sure to pack sturdy, comfortable shoes that will keep you going for long walks without any discomfort. The right footwear is essential for enjoying your journey, allowing you to truly immerse yourself in the experience while discovering every corner of your destination.
  • Light, Versatile Clothing: Choose clothing that is easy to mix and match and can adapt to various weather conditions, giving you flexibility during your travels.
  • A Journal or Notebook: Slow travel is about reflection and connection. Keeping a travel journal will not only enhance your experience but also allow you to document your thoughts and observations, enriching the memories you create.
  • Local SIM Card or Wi-Fi Hotspot: Stay connected while fully immersing yourself in the local culture. With a local SIM card or portable Wi-Fi hotspot, you’ll have easy access to maps, translation tools, and the ability to stay in touch with loved ones, all while enjoying the freedom to explore your destination at your own pace.
